Citizens of the Russian Federation are offended when they meet the inscription Durak in the cities of Turkey
Russian tourists who come to Turkey for the first time are often embarrassed and offended when they see an inscription or sign Durak on the street. This is reported Sport24.
It is noted that the word Durak in Turkish means “stop” and does not carry a negative connotation. It is also sometimes used as a stop sign.
In addition, the authors of the material drew attention to the fact that words of Turkic origin can be found in the Russian language. So, Russians often use the words “shoe”, “trap” and “barn” in their speech.
